level 发表于 2013-10-11 13:12:59

高13上67的题 一些想法

今天 看了江山老师的   2013年下半年高级信息系统项目管理师考试江山老师必过神系列葵花宝典之运筹学计算篇
(http://www.51kpm.com/thread-23104-1-1.html )下载的视频,听江山老师说对于(高13上67的题)没有好的方法,我把自己对这个题有点看法 写出来 和大家交流一下,主要思想是 分片取最小值。

题目如下:
2013年上半年信息系统项目管理师真题第67题:编号1、2、3、4、5、6的6个城市的距离矩阵如表2所示,设推销员从1城出发,

编号1、2、3、4、5、6的6个城市的距离矩阵如表2所示,设推销员从1城出发,经过每个城市一次且仅一次,最后回到1城,选择适当的路线,推销员最短的行程是( )公里
        1        2        3        4        5        6
1        0        10        20        30        40        50
2        12        0        18        30        25        21
3        23        9        0        5        10        15
4        34        32        4        0        8        16
5        45        27        11        10        0        18
6        56        22        16        20        12        0


A、75    B、78   C、80   D、100

思路:
根据题目 从城市1开始每个城市经过一次且一次。我们使用逆向最小值,到1的最小点城市从表中看是2是最小(10)
1<-----2(10) ,1和2组合
观察3,4,5,6之间的行程发现, 3与4之间距离最小,所以 3-4之间是组合,取最小的 4<-----3(4)。
剩下的让5-6组合 取最小的6<-----5(12)
分成3组后 因为1是最后回到的点 所以   1<-----2(10)在最后 ,则结果只有2中可能

1<-----2(10)<-----4(30)<-----3(4)<-----6(16)<-----5(12)<-----1(45)
或者
1<-----2(10)<-----6(21)<-----5(12)<-----4(10)<-----3(4)<-----1(23)

在计算得到 前者为117 后者为80则应当是

1<-----2(10)<-----6(21)<-----5(12)<-----4(10)<-----3(4)<-----1(23)
答案应当是80。

alpyh2 发表于 2013-10-13 10:40:46

有没有这种可能 4-->3和6-->5 ,导致了 这两组之间的的距离特别长,影响总距离???个人想法,有不正确的地方请指出,多交流

level 发表于 2013-10-15 17:52:50

理论上这种可能也是有的,每个每个城市只能经过一次,也就是每个城市只有一个出和进。而且1,2的位置固定啦。在结合答案小于100所以,结合里边的路径的数字综合考虑。
如何要按照原理运筹学的背包原理去计算,那个量太大啦,不适合考试。有什么疑问提出来 可以相互交流,互相学习。可以加我QQ:445203853.
页: [1]
查看完整版本: 高13上67的题 一些想法